// PR tree-optimization/83239 - False positive from -Wstringop-overflow // on simple std::vector code // { dg-do compile } // { dg-options "-O3 -finline-limit=500 -Wall -fdump-tree-optimized" } #include <vector> // Verify no warnings are issued. template <class T> void test_loop () { std::vector<T> a; int num = 2; while (num > 0) { const typename std::vector<T>::size_type sz = a.size (); if (sz < 3) a.assign (1, 0); else a.resize (sz - 2); --num; } } // Verify no warnings are issued here either. template <class T> void test_if (std::vector<T> &a, int num) { if (num > 0) { const typename std::vector<T>::size_type sz = a.size (); if (sz < 3) a.assign (1, 0); else a.resize (sz - 2); } } // Instantiate each function on a different type to force both // to be fully inlined. Instantiating both on the same type // causes the inlining heuristics to outline _M_default_append // which, in turn, masks the warning. template void test_loop<int>(); template void test_if<long>(std::vector<long>&, int); // Verify that std::vector<T>::_M_default_append() has been inlined // (the absence of warnings depends on it). // { dg-final { scan-tree-dump-not "_ZNSt6vectorIiSaIiEE17_M_default_appendEm" optimized } } // { dg-final { scan-tree-dump-not "_ZNSt6vectorIPvSaIS0_EE17_M_default_appendEm" optimized } }
